Predictive model of electrical therapy failure in paroxysmal atrial fibrillation
Introduction: Atrial fibrillation is the most common recurrent arrhythmia in clinical practice. Its prevalence is multiplying in the current population and has different pathophysiological causes that make it a global pandemic.
